"The political media did not create Donald Trump," says David Leonhardt, editor of The Upshot for The New York Times. In fact, if calculations are correct, interest in Trump is actually outstripping coverage. But still: how to explain media fervor over unserious candidates like Trump this month and Herman Cain in 2012? Leonhardt talks to Brooke about the media's real power in the boom-and-bust cycles of political coverage, and why the extra scrutiny could extinguish Trump's flare sooner.
